Dunno abouyt fruity but in logic when you select a new instrument and select battery 4 go to multi output as the option then you can expand the regions in the mixer menu via a little plus button.
then in each individual drum cell in battery if you double click on each cell there should be a output option at the bottom of the menu, go to that and select which output you want to link each cell to.
